| 查看: 489 | 回复: 0 | |||
[求助]
求助,微分代数方程组
|
|
function dx = yuanpan4(t,x) m=10;r=0.5;k=100;g=9.8;u=0.4; dx=zeros(5,1); if x(4)>0 dx(1)=x(2); dx(2)=(-k*x(1)+x(5))/m; dx(3)= (-2*x(5))/(m*r); dx(4)=x(2)-r*x(3)-x(4); dx(5)= x(5)+m*g*u; elseif x(4)==0 dx(1)=x(2); dx(2)=(-k*x(1)+x(5))/m; dx(3)=(-2*x(5))/(m*r); dx(4)=x(2)-r*x(3)-x(4); dx(5)=0; else dx(1)=x(2); dx(2)=(-k*x(1)+x(5))/m; dx(3)=(-2*x(5))/(m*r); dx(4)=x(2)-r*x(3)-x(4); dx(5)=x(5)-m*g*u; end end 这是函数。 tspan=[0,16]; x0=[3;3;5;0.5;-39.2]; M=diag([1,1,1,0,0]); options=odeset('Mass',M,'RelTol',1e-6,'AbsTol',[1e-10,1e-10,1e-10,1e-10,1e-10]); [t,x]=ode15s(@yuanpan4,tspan,x0,options);plot(t,x(:,1),'-b',t,x(:,4),'-r',t,x(:,5),'-g'); grid on; 这是主程序。 Warning: Failure at t=1.192445e-02. Unable to meet integration tolerances without reducing the step size below the smallest value allowed (2.775558e-17) at time t. 这是错误提示 |
» 猜你喜欢
求标准粉末衍射卡号 ICDD 01-076-1802
已经有0人回复
新西兰Robinson研究所招收全奖PhD
已经有0人回复
物理学I论文润色/翻译怎么收费?
已经有226人回复
石墨烯转移--二氧化硅衬底石墨烯
已经有0人回复
笼目材料中量子自旋液体基态的证据
已经有0人回复
数学教学论硕士可以读数学物理博士吗?
已经有0人回复
德国亥姆霍兹Hereon中心汉堡分部招镁合金腐蚀裂变SCC课题方向2026公派博士生
已经有4人回复
澳门大学 应用物理及材料工程研究院 潘晖教授课题组诚招博士后
已经有11人回复
求助NH4V4O10晶体的CIF文件
已经有0人回复
英国全奖博士招聘-深度学习与量子物理
已经有0人回复
间接带隙半导体有效质量求助
已经有0人回复
找到一些相关的精华帖子,希望有用哦~
帮忙:求解一组微分代数方程,奖励100金币
已经有7人回复
matlab 解非线性偏微分方程组
已经有6人回复
请问这个偏微分方程组有一般的解法么?
已经有12人回复
求解线性代数的问题
已经有5人回复
matlab求三元4次符号代数方程组,出现warning且答案不正确,该怎么办?
已经有12人回复
matlab 非线性微分方程求解
已经有3人回复
求推荐求解偏微分方程组的书
已经有3人回复
搞传热的虫子求助:遇到有变量相乘的偏微分方程组如何离散?
已经有16人回复
求助-帮我用mathematics计算下下面的方程组
已经有13人回复
matlab解偏微分方程求助
已经有12人回复
【求助】matlab求解偏微分方程
已经有4人回复
求助matlab拟合方程组
已经有12人回复
偏微分方程数值计算书籍推荐
已经有10人回复
第5章_解线性方程组的直接方法.ppt
已经有13人回复
matlab求解非线性方程组
已经有16人回复
matlab数值求解边界条件微分方程组
已经有7人回复
【求助】有限元法求解二阶偏微分方程组
已经有6人回复
科研从小木虫开始,人人为我,我为人人













回复此楼
点击这里搜索更多相关资源